Output 21d7e7ad25ab1543ff1fab26b2326c3b1da1b5a9998a2447b7334d163cb9f646:1

value
1774600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0068ba7059a44e707927ff78c661e6792fd554de OP_EQUAL
address
D5BFzuYL8VW5jpYqx7bhevtnXrGYmW6SPe
transaction
21d7e7ad25ab1543ff1fab26b2326c3b1da1b5a9998a2447b7334d163cb9f646
spent
true